Why he matters right now

Keider Montero is top-10 in the majors in WHIP

He is 6th in WHIP at 1.03 — placements on MLB's own season boards, which rank every QUALIFIED pitcher in the sport rather than the few dozen this site tracks. Qualified is MLB's own bar, and it is the reason a part-season player with a big number is not on these boards at all.

This has been his headline for 7 straight days.

The honest caveat

A top-ten finish is a position on a board, not a verdict on a player. The men just below him on it are not meaningfully worse, and one good week moves several places.
